Hey Priya — wrapping up the stale-cache postmortem for Burrowlight before you take over review. Root cause was the invalidation hook firing before the write committed, so readers kept serving ghosts. Fix is in the linked branch; mostly it tightens the commit ordering plus shorter TTLs. Please sanity-check the new values against what prod actually runs. Here's the config the fix assumes.

service settings:
PRAIX_LOG_LEVEL=error
PRAIX_METRICS_HOST=metrics.praix.qorvelcorp.corp
PRAIX_POOL_SIZE=16

## Alert: StatRelay Sidecar Flush Lag

This alert fires when the StatRelay metrics-aggregation sidecar falls more than 120 seconds behind on flushing buffered samples to the Coalmine backend. Plugin-emitted counters are buffered in-process, so sustained lag usually means a plugin is emitting unbounded label cardinality or blocking the flush thread. Check your plugin's metric registration against the published cardinality limits before escalating. If the lag persists after your plugin is ruled out, contact the telemetry team.

escalation mailbox, bagug-fahof: novdor.wendor.jormir@norvalabs.example

Handover Note to the Board

Outgoing Director P. Ashgrove to incoming Director L. Fenn. The pilot with retail chain Morrowvale Stores is midway: eight locations live, sell-through ahead of forecast, logistics via the Keldbrook depot performing well. Morrowvale's buying team expects a decision meeting next quarter. All pilot documentation is filed with the secretariat. The expansion intentions are noted below.

internal memo for kawip-hadug: Headcount on the Wenwyn team goes from 7 to 140 by the end of January. Gross margin on Wenwyn came in at 20 percent against a plan of 15 percent.

Key ceremony checklist, item 7 (Brindlehook consent banner rollout): Confirm that the signing key used to attest the banner configuration bundle has been generated inside the Vaultrix enclave, witnessed by two officers, and that the old key is marked retired in the ledger. Verify the rollout manifest hash matches the value read aloud during the ceremony. Before sealing the envelope, the officiant must record the recovery passphrase for the escrow shard; it appears immediately below this item.

vault phrase of bagaf-kajeg = jorath-feniel-briir-siliel-ralix